英 [p??]? ?美 [p??]??

vt.& vi.推,推動

vt.按;推動,增加;對…施加壓力,逼迫;說服

n.推,決心;大規(guī)模攻勢;矢志的追求

vi.推進;增加;努力爭取

第三人稱單數(shù): pushes 現(xiàn)在分詞: pushing 過去式: pushed 過去分詞: pushed

javascript push()方法 語法

push()方法怎么用?

push() 方法可以用于向數(shù)組的末尾添加一個或多個元素,并返回新的長度,push() 方法可把它的參數(shù)順序添加到arrayObject 的尾部,可以直接修改arrayObject,而不是創(chuàng)建一個新的數(shù)組。

作用:向數(shù)組的末尾添加一個或多個元素,并返回新的長度。

語法:arrayObject.push(newelement1,newelement2,....,newelementX)

參數(shù):newelement1 ? ?必需。要添加到數(shù)組的第一個元素。? ? newelement2 ? ?可選。要添加到數(shù)組的第二個元素。? ? newelementX ? ?可選??商砑佣鄠€元素。? ??

返回:把指定的值添加到數(shù)組后的新長度。

說明:push() 方法可把它的參數(shù)順序添加到 arrayObject 的尾部。它直接修改 arrayObject,而不是創(chuàng)建一個新的數(shù)組。push() 方法和 pop() 方法使用數(shù)組提供的先進后出棧的功能。

注釋:該方法會改變數(shù)組的長度。要想數(shù)組的開頭添加一個或多個元素,請使用 unshift() 方法。

javascript push()方法 示例

<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>Title</title>
</head>
<body>
<script type="text/javascript">

    var arr = new Array(3)
    arr[0] = "George"
    arr[1] = "John"
    arr[2] = "Thomas"

    document.write(arr + "<br />")
    document.write(arr.push("James") + "<br />")
    document.write(arr)

</script>
</body>
</html>

運行實例 ?

點擊 "運行實例" 按鈕查看在線實例